The processes you should not automate

Most writing about automation is about what to automate next. This is about the opposite question, which I think gets asked far too rarely: what should you deliberately leave alone?

Not "can't be automated" — the list of genuinely impossible things shrinks every year. I mean processes where automation is technically achievable and still makes the business worse. These exist, they're more common than the discourse suggests, and recognising them early saves a lot of money.

Five categories I've come to watch for.

1. Processes whose real output is a relationship

Some work produces two things: a deliverable and a relationship. The deliverable is visible and measurable. The relationship isn't, so it doesn't appear in the process map — and it's the thing that gets destroyed.

A check-in call that produces a short status update is the obvious example. The status update is the stated output and could be generated automatically in seconds. But the call also surfaces the thing the client wasn't going to raise formally, maintains the habit of contact that makes bad news arrive early rather than late, and constitutes most of why they renew.

Automate the status update and you'll get a status update. You will also, six months later, have a client relationship that has gone quiet, and you won't connect the two.

The tell: ask what would be lost if this process produced its output perfectly but no human contact occurred. If the answer takes more than a moment, be careful.

2. Processes that are secretly training

Junior people learn by doing work that is, viewed narrowly, beneath them. Reviewing routine cases, preparing first drafts, handling standard requests. It's inefficient — that's exactly why it's the first thing flagged for automation.

But that work is how pattern recognition gets built. Someone who has personally worked through four hundred routine cases develops an instinct for the one that isn't routine. You cannot get that from a training deck.

Automate the entire bottom of the ladder and you get an immediate efficiency gain and a capability gap that shows up in three years, when you need senior people and discover you have no pipeline to make them from. By then nobody attributes it to the automation decision.

I'm not arguing for preserving busywork. I'm arguing that "this work is too basic for a person" and "this work is how people learn" are frequently true of the same process, and the second one has a much longer time horizon than any efficiency calculation you'll run.

3. Processes where the failure mode is silent and expensive

Some processes fail loudly. The output is obviously wrong, someone notices immediately, it gets fixed.

Others fail silently — the output looks entirely plausible and is wrong. A misclassification that routes something to the wrong place. A summary that omits the one material detail. A number that's off by an amount nobody would question.

For these, automation doesn't remove the human; it changes the human's job from doing to catching. And people are dramatically worse at catching errors in plausible-looking output than at avoiding them while doing the work. Vigilance decays fast, especially when the system is right 95% of the time — which is precisely when it's most dangerous, because trust builds and attention drops.

Before automating, ask: if this is confidently wrong, how long until anyone notices, and what does it cost by then? If the answer is "months" and "a lot," the automation needs to be designed around detection rather than throughput, or not built at all.

4. Processes that change faster than you can maintain them

An automation is a snapshot of how a process worked when you built it. If the process is stable, that's fine for years. If it changes every quarter, you've bought a maintenance obligation that may exceed what you were spending on the manual version.

This is easy to miss because maintenance cost is invisible at build time and shows up later distributed across many small updates that never get totalled. Nobody ever computes the annual cost of keeping an automation current. If you did, some of them would clearly be worse than the manual process they replaced.

Rough heuristic: if the underlying rules have changed twice in the last year, be honest about maintenance before you build. And build for changeability over efficiency — a slower, more configurable system beats a faster brittle one for anything volatile.

5. Processes nobody has questioned in five years

Not a "don't automate" so much as a "don't automate yet."

If a process has run unexamined for years, the chance that it's still the right process is not high. Business context changed, systems were replaced, the original reason may have dissolved entirely. What survives is a process that runs because it runs.

Automating it is the worst possible response. You'd be investing in permanence for something that hasn't justified its existence recently, and making it cheaper to run guarantees nobody will ever question it again.

Examine it first. A meaningful fraction of the time, the process can be simplified dramatically or removed outright — which is a far better outcome than automating it well.

The uncomfortable version

There's a commercial tension here I should name, since I run delivery at a company that builds these systems.

The incentive in AI services runs toward automating more. More scope, more build, more contract. Telling a client that a process should be deleted rather than automated is directly against short-term interest.

It's also the only way to be worth keeping around. A vendor who has told you not to build something is a vendor whose recommendation to build something actually means anything. Every implementation that quietly gets abandoned costs more in credibility than it earned in fees — you just don't see the invoice.

The test I'd apply, both as a buyer and a builder: does the case for automating this survive contact with the question "what would we lose?" If nobody's asked that question, it's too early to build.
